Bozigit Islamgereev’s Buzzer-Beating ‘Flying Squirrel’ Lifts Him Into U23 European 86 kg Final

The high-risk somersaulting takedown, popularized by U.S. Olympian Ellis Coleman, returned to the spotlight in Zrenjanin with a decisive four-point throw.

  • He overturned France’s Rakhim Magamadov 10–8 with a last-second ‘flying squirrel’ at the U23 European Championships in Zrenjanin, Serbia.
  • The sequence saw Islamgereev vault over Magamadov’s head, lock an inverted body grip on landing, and drive him onto his back for the decisive points.
  • He advanced through the bracket by edging Azerbaijan’s Vasif Khudiyev 3–2 in the semifinal.
  • He is set to wrestle Turkey’s Ahmet Yagan in the 86 kg gold-medal match, with no result reported yet in the provided coverage.
  • United World Wrestling’s clip of the move went viral, and Islamgereev described the attempt as instinctive, with the technique’s lineage tied to Ellis Coleman’s famed version.
